July
In July, Tampa is constantly hot, somewhat rainy and very stormy. Temperatures routinely are in the low 90s F (low 30s C) range. At night, lows are in the 70s F (mid 20s C). This is also a rainy time for Tampa, with more than half of the days of the month having rain. In July, humidity reaches as high as 70%.

September
In September, Tampa can be very hot, somewhat rainy and somewhat stormy. Temperatures routinely are in the high 80s F (low 30s C) and about half of the time jump into the low 90s F (low 30s C) range. At night, lows are in the 70s F (mid 20s C). This is also a rainy time for Tampa, with several of the days of the month having rain. In September, humidity reaches as high as 70%.
